If you did not initiate setting up or changing an account, emails that arrive out of the blue that ask for your login details are scams.
In fact, when you do set up a new account with an online service, the company often sends a confirmation email to you, showing you what your chosen user name and password is. Emails asking you for a password are called phishing scams.

I've seen that screen before. If you actually have a Dropbox account, then you just enter in your user name and password. If you don't have an account, you need to create one.
Dropbox is not really a music streaming site, as far as I know. It's just a place in the "cloud" where you can store files. Then you can access them anywhere in the world (well, maybe not in some countries). I use a few different cloud storage services (none are big enough for all my files I want access to) so I can access files on my iPad, Android phone wherever I may be.
You can share your Dropbox folder with others. Maybe that is why you are thinking that Dropbox is a music streaming site.
If you get this when you click on an icon on your desktop, or elsewhere on your computer for Dropbox, I would think it is safe to assume this screen is safe and not a hacker. If you received something by email, and you clicked it and got this screen, I would stop right there.
